Biography - The Story of Rhonda McCullough

Rhonda McCullough’s life story, in some respects, is a quiet yet very powerful one, closely linked to the well-known journey of her late husband, comedian Bernie Mac. Their connection began when they were just teenagers, a sweet high school romance that, you know, blossomed into a lifelong partnership. She was only sixteen when they tied the knot in 1977, a decision that marked the beginning of a shared existence that would see them through many different phases of life.

For decades, she was right there with him, offering steadfast backing as he pursued his passion for making people laugh, a path that eventually led him to widespread recognition and fame. His career, from the early days of stand-up to becoming a beloved actor, had her constant presence as a quiet anchor. Then, when he passed away in 2008, it marked a truly significant turning point in her life, a moment of profound sadness that, you know, reshaped her world entirely.

After a period of intense grief, Rhonda McCullough made the personal choice to find a new chapter in her life, marrying Horace Gilmore in 2011. This decision, made only a few years after Bernie Mac’s death, showed a remarkable resilience and a willingness to embrace new beginnings, which is, honestly, quite brave. Beyond her personal life, she has also taken on a significant role in preserving Bernie Mac’s memory and continuing his work through the Bernie Mac Foundation, serving as its leader and guiding its efforts. She is, as a matter of fact, a film and television producer too, adding another layer to her professional life.

What is the Bernie Mac Foundation's Mission Under Rhonda McCullough?

The Bernie Mac Foundation stands as a significant part of Rhonda McCullough’s life’s work, a direct continuation of her late husband’s spirit and concerns. She serves as the president and chief executive officer of this charitable group, which means she guides its overall direction and daily operations. The main goal of the foundation is to raise awareness about sarcoidosis, the condition that ultimately took Bernie Mac’s life. This is, you know, a very personal mission for her.

Through initiatives like "Project Purple" and "Mission Sarcoidosis Awareness," the foundation works to bring attention to this illness, which is, in some respects, not as widely known as other conditions. Rhonda McCullough’s hope is to build upon the rich legacy that Bernie Mac left behind, extending his influence beyond entertainment into public health and awareness. Yes, Rhonda McCullough did, in fact, pursue legal action following Bernie Mac’s passing, which is, you know, a very serious step to take. She filed a wrongful death lawsuit in Chicago against her husband’s dermatologist, Dr. Rene M. Earles. The basis of this lawsuit was her claim that Dr. Earles did not recognize signs of Bernie Mac’s respiratory failure when he saw him on July 17, 2008. She alleged that this delay in getting him emergency care contributed to his death.
